Post Graduate Certificate in Supply Chain Management - Logistics (Co-Op)- SCM2

This one-year post-grad supply chain management certification is designed for university and college graduates looking to specialize in supply chain and logistics. You will be trained to join private or public sectors in the areas of goods and services sourcing, transportation coordinating and inventory and distribution management. You’ll also learn how to analyze using computer software and accounting skills, how to communicate in a professional manner, how to assess risk and develop your negotiating skills.

Job Opportunity Potential

Graduates will be prepared for a variety of supply chain management roles, from entry-level to more senior positions, in service, manufacturing or government sectors, depending on prior education and work experience.  Graduates will be in high demand in all functions of the supply chain positions such as buyer, purchasing assistant, logistics coordinator, inventory analyst,  transportation coordinator, material planner / expediter, production planner / scheduler, operations coordinator, warehouse supervisor and supply chain manager.

 

Admission Requirement / Eligibility Criteria

  • A Two- or Three-Year College Diploma, or a Degree
    (Note: minimum 'C+' average or cumulative 2.5 GPA)
    OR
    Acceptable combination of related work experience and post-secondary education as judged by the College*
    OR
    Five years of work experience in the supply chain management field as judged by the College to be equivalent*


Note:

*Applicants may be required to submit a resume and cover letter that includes details of work experience.
